Rubber Roof Cleaning in Vancouver, WA
Rubber roof cleaning services involve the removal of dirt, algae, moss, and debris from the surface of rubber roofing materials commonly used on residential properties. This process helps maintain the roof’s appearance, extend its lifespan, and prevent potential damage caused by the buildup of organic growth or accumulated grime. Projects typically include cleaning flat or low-slope rubber roofs on homes, garages, or outbuildings, ensuring that the roof remains in good condition and continues to provide effective protection against the elements.
Property owners considering rubber roof cleaning should understand the importance of choosing appropriate cleaning methods that do not compromise the integrity of the roofing material. It’s helpful to inquire about the types of cleaning solutions used, the equipment involved, and whether any repairs or inspections are recommended as part of the service. Proper cleaning can improve curb appeal and help identify potential issues early, supporting the longevity and performance of the roof over time.

Rubber Roof Cleaning Questions
What is involved in cleaning a rubber roof? The process typically includes removing debris, inspecting for damage, and applying specialized cleaning solutions to eliminate dirt, moss, and algae.
Can rubber roof cleaning extend its lifespan? Regular cleaning helps maintain the roof's condition and can prevent deterioration caused by buildup and biological growth.
Is rubber roof cleaning safe for the material? Yes, professional cleaning uses gentle, appropriate methods that do not harm the rubber surface or its waterproofing properties.
How often should a rubber roof be cleaned? It is recommended to schedule cleaning at least once a year or when noticeable dirt, moss, or algae growth appears.
